Database Admin

Job Responsibilities:

This position is responsible for maintaining an Enterprise
implementation of Remedy 7.0 for the ITIL service management
processes. This includes supporting developers, business analysts and
customers to configure implement and integrate the Remedy application
to support the business needs. The ideal candidate will have 5+ years
Remedy administration experience including experience in a CMMI level
3+ organizations. Position level is dependent on candidate’s level of
experience.

* Maintain stable operation of the BMC Remedy ITSM systems and CMDB. *
Maintain resilient Remedy infrastructure, resolve issues related to
out of the box functionality and provide customer support. *
Responsible for system configuration data and any changes to the
system requiring systems administrative access. * Coordinate/perform
major system upgrades * Install/Upgrade software and application
software * Maintain system configuration data within all applications
in the ITSM suite (HD, AM, CM, SLA) * Import data from other sources
into Remedy. * Create Login access for individual users and groups *
License management for all BMC Remedy products * Work with Procurement
for License key management * User license management (fixed and
floating)

Qualifications:

*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or Business Administration or
related discipline * BMC training for ITSM preferred. * Remedy 7.0
required
